Epub 2 media queries screen

It is a range feature, meaning you can also use the prefixed minaspectratio and maxaspectratio variants to query minimum and maximum values, respectively. Media queries is css code that allows you to target css rules based on screen size, deviceorientation and other device elements. How to take a screen shot on any kindle paperwhite, touch. A media query computes to true when the media type if specified matches the device on which a document is being displayed and all media feature expressions compute as true. Media overlay document epub 3 allows media overlay documents to describe the timing for the prerecorded audio narration and how it relates to the epub content document markup. Remember the gvido, that dual screen sheet music reader which is expected to ship later this year charbax has found a second such device from another japanese company, design m plus. Use features like bookmarks, note taking and highlighting while reading responsive web design in 24 hours, sams teach yourself. The file format for media overlays is defined as a subset of smil. Add media queries to this stylesheet this is an option dropdown list that allows you to select the right stylesheet from your epub to add the media queries. Responsive web design in 24 hours, sams teach yourself. The calibre builtin e book viewer has been completely rewritten. What is more interesting to me, as an owner of three different epub 2 devices, is. Create richlayout publications in epub 3 with html5, css3. Kindle comic creator kindle panel view a variation on fixed layouts for images.

While cover images are not required in the epub specs, amazon highly suggests that all books include an interior cover image. How to read epub on your kindle the digital reader. This page lists a ton of different devices and media queries that would specifically target that device. The content flows, or reflows, to fit the screen and to fit the needs of the user.

Css media queries level 4 indeed is going to provide 2. Media queries enable us to create a responsive website design rwd where specific styles are applied to small screens, large screens, and anywhere in between. Css3 media queries conditional directives for different. Blitztricks css tricks to improve your ebooks github pages. This app lets you view one epub book at a time, or two at a time if you prefer in a split screen view. Is it possible to use media queries to choose fixed layout pages. Beginners guide to media queries learn web development. Codify academy, introduction to media queries and how they work. Author kevin callahan shows how to prepare an indesign file for ebook output, export the text and image assets, add them to the kindle template, and build in special features such as region magnification, popups, and media queries that adjust your books display to the readers device. Jun 29, 2015 for the longest time this blogger has liked and recommended sigil as an opensource epub creation app. The current epub implementation you see on most readers and devices is for epub 2. Both the epub 2 and epub 3 ocf specifications instruct reading.

That image should be marked in the opf file using the standard epub 2 or epub 3 methods. Sep 16, 2010 it turns out i know the people who did it, and yes, they are actually reading an epub ebook. As noted in rendering and css content presentation adapts to the user, rather than the user having to adapt to a particular presentation of content. He caught up with the company when it was exhibiting its musik device at cebit earlier this year as you can see in the following video the dual screen version of the musik looks a lot like the gvido. Css device media queries enjoy this cheat sheet at its fullest within dash, the macos documentation browser. Contribute to friendsofepubblitz development by creating an account on github. Kindlegen will indeed take them into account when converting your epub file. On a wide desktop display, we want to present information in columns, and as screen width diminishes below a threshold, we stack elements vertically. It supports the latest versions of html, css, and svg, and has builtin support for embedded interactivity, audio, and video. New standards developments in css are providing a better future for developers that needs to detect touch devices just with their css. This appendix intends to clarify that note until the specification is updated accordingly. Jul 01, 2016 to learn more about media queries and responsive design for ebooks, read sanders kleinfelds article responsive ebook design.

Since bootstrap is developed to be mobile first, we use a handful of media queries to create sensible breakpoints for our layouts and interfaces. The media query syntax allows for the creation of rules that can be applied depending on device characteristics. Welcome to the latest installment of the epub secrets link post, where we curate the top stories related to digital publishing. Download the latest version of the validator to work with epub 2 and epub 3 documents. Eliots the waste land in a single xhtml document, using elements and the epub. With modern css, solutions to this problem have become easier than in the past. Media queries for mobile, laptop, desktop and ipad for. Media type the mime media type used to represent the given publication resource in the manifest. Our css editor pro with our own css parser and css serializer. The latter determines if the result of the query is true or false. Currently, he works as a publishing technologies specialist, maintaining oreillys xmlbased toolchain for generating epub and mobi formats of both frontlist and backlist. Because of this, ive ended up with a somewhat large list of css media queries for typical devices over the past year or two. If youre looking for free epub book downloads, know that there are lots of online resources where you can find free books, such as open library. Simply put, media queries define the modules in css3 which enables rendering so that the content adapts to different conditions like screen resolution.

This prior question is about the differences between epub 2 and epub 3. Unlike using maxwidth, window resize will not affect it. Dont do this it doesnt end up making your stylesheets more organized. Creating media queries for responsive web designs the following is an exclusive extract from my new book, jump start responsive web design, 2nd edition. Its free, easy to use, and can be used to make a standard epub ebook. The font you use in your ebooks, arsenal, is much too thin to read on screen. Css3 media queries for all devices and browsers ie7, ie8. You can also use media queries to specify that certain styles are only for printed documents or for screen readers mediatype. Css media query cheat sheet with foundation github. You can change the page by waving your hand over the proximity sensor. Epub 2 provides all the formatting and layout capabilities of xhtml 1.

Why ebook images can cut into your profits weve been talking about pixels in ebook images and screen resolution, but the actual file size of your image is also important to consider. Thats probably not generally a great practice, but it is. This means you can use css media queries to tweak a css for an ipad, printer or create a responsive site. Heres a quick list of media queries to specify kindle devices and. Typical to add on media queries for both smaller and wider styles css before media queries is default can take different approach when starting from scratch start with mobile, layer on wider styles. This means you can use css media queries to tweak your css code to display styles like fonts, widths, hide divs, or any css style differently on ipad, iphone, android and other mobile devices, creating a responsive site. Thats probably not generally a great practice, but it is helpful to know what the dimensions for all these devices are in a css context. Jaypanoz opened this issue on mar 25, 2016 2 comments. The columns in the table represent the following information. Do not ever let them empty in your epub file since that would crash the legacy rmsdk and all the reading systems using it. To declare an epub 2 file as fixedlayout or interactive, a file named. The css media query gives you a way to apply css only when the browser and device environment matches a rule that you specify, for example viewport is wider than 480 pixels. Get the complete suite of xslt and python tools for converting ncx files into ends.

Essential considerations for crafting quality media queries. It illustrates about epub file which is an ebook file format, common epub errors and how to resolve broken file issues with an effective way to recover ebook corruption and damaged which are occurring due to various external as well as internal factors. Bluegriffon editing one of the media queries of a responsive web site. The only two media types i use are print and screen, which is a bit of a catchall for any screen based device including mobile devices, tv and projection. A media query is composed of an optional media type and any number of media feature expressions. How to take a screen shot on any kindle paperwhite, touch, basic, keyboard 3 october, 2014 11 may, 2017 kindle, tips and tricks 24 comments the kindle can do many things, but not all of them are explained in the user manual.

Many times ive had to design responsive websites targeting specific devices with css media queries, and not just base the break points from the sites content. Toc support from the epub file toc but it will not appear inline. One pitfall that is common when developing a responsive app is creating another file called responsive. One of these is css page templates, with the current module documentation released on january 19, 2012 you might want to view the in chrome to see the proper markup in the document. Media queries are commonly used to control responsive layouts on websites. The following table lists the epub 3 core media types. Customizing the default breakpoints for your project. But if required, you can use css media queries to apply different styles for different screen formats and several other issues.

Our guide to responsive media queries for all devices teaches you all about how to use css media queries, set break points and more. This can be used as a way to alter html content between the two different formats. Mar 20, 2012 responsive web design by ethan marcotte. Its development was chartered in 2009, and the final standard was approved by the idpf membership as a recommended specification in may, 2010. Media queries are a key part of responsive web design, as they allow you to create different layouts depending on the size of the viewport, but they can also be used to detect other things about the environment your site. Jul 31, 2012 ryan boudreaux shows how to create media queries that allow the web designer to target styles based on a number of device properties, such as screen width, orientation, and resolution. The aspectratio css media feature can be used to test the aspect ratio of the viewport syntax.

How to protect your amazon ebooks from being deleted amazon recently erased all of one kindle users ebooks. Explore css techniques and design principles, including fluid grids, flexible images, and media queries. This document informatively describes the changes in epub 3 from the previous release, epub 2. These styles will need to be overridden in the default css or with media queries to ensure your file looks the same in both formats. I cant believe no one has mentioned the obvious css media queries. The width media feature describes the width of the targeted display area of the output device. While i was trying to figure out how they read epub on the kindle i came up with a whole other solution. These breakpoints are mostly based on minimum viewport widths and allow us to scale up elements as the viewport changes. Oct 18, 20 the size of the screen is typically not relevant, because often the useragent does not use the complete screen, therefore css does not care much about this. Alternatively, you can detect the width of the display screen using. Im still in the middle of finding out how they did it, but it doesnt matter. You could do media queries for screen dimensions, but there is no way to use these to control what is present in the spine to my knowledge.

According to the changelog, one of the major improvementschanges was a new ebook viewer. If you use calibre to manage your ebook library and are fond of its ebook reading function, you might want to hold off on the latest update. Media queries will allow us to change our layouts to suit the exact need of different devices without changing the content. Content type definition the specification to which the given core media type resource has to conform.

This article is an effort to resolve user queries to repair epub file manually with the aid of epub validator and zip extraction method. Css media queries are formally included in the epub 3 css profile, which. If pages are arbitrarily sized to account for a multiplicity of screen form factors. Read epub books on your phone with split screen epub. We can add a breakpoint where certain parts of the design will behave differently on each side of the. Repair epub file with epub check validator manual ebook. Svg an epub feature, can be zoomed with no loss of fidelity. If you know how to write your own css, youll be able to. Just like if a reboot was related to the algorithm involved in rendering epub 3 files on screen. Media query is built on media type and one or more expressions that include media features. If for some reason you must add or override styles for kindle, those two media queries can help.

Media queries are one of the most exciting aspects about css today. Responsive media queries for all devices with css examples. The aspectratio feature is specified as a value representing the widthtoheight aspect ratio of the viewport. As a result, most ereading apps and devices for this spec do no support media. Css media queries allow you to target css rules based on for instance screen size, deviceorientation or displaydensity. Using css media queries is the most widely adapted solution in the wordpress community if you want to make sure your website is responsive. In this video, i explore what media queries are and how you can start using them right away. I was catching up on conversations on twitter when i came across an offhand mention of epub3. Multiple queries can be combined in various ways by using logical operators. As a result, most ereading apps and devices for this spec do no support media queries in the css. Epub, ibooks and kindle media queries mobileread forums.

Its highly unlikely that there are some frontend developers involved in a responsive website development who are not familiar with the concept of css media queries. In this post, ill be looking at magento 2 way of implementing this functionality in its default theme development workflow. The stylesheet that you choose should be the main stylesheet that is used to style all text files and images in your epub. Of course, it was probably a bigger deal when kindle announced their support for media queries. Sanders kleinfeld has been employed at oreilly media since 2004 and has held a variety of positions, including roles on oreillys production, editorial, and tools teams. Epub documents, unlike print books or pdf files, are designed to change. These media queries have one special benefit that other media queries do not. How to create media queries in responsive web design. The keys are your screen names used as the prefix for the responsive utility variants tailwind generates, like md.